The Technology Behind the Swing

Let's dive into the tech! The technology behind the swing in a Tiger Woods golf simulator bar is seriously impressive. We're not just talking about a screen and a projector, guys. These simulators use a combination of high-speed cameras, infrared sensors, and sophisticated software to create a realistic golfing experience. The cameras track the club's movement throughout the swing, measuring parameters like clubhead speed, swing path, and face angle. The sensors monitor the ball's launch angle, spin rate, and direction immediately after impact. All this data is then fed into the software, which uses complex algorithms to simulate the flight of the ball and its interaction with the virtual course. The graphics are incredibly realistic, with detailed renderings of famous golf courses from around the world. You'll feel like you're actually standing on the tee box at Pebble Beach or St. Andrews. The simulators also take into account environmental factors like wind speed and direction, which can affect the ball's trajectory. Some simulators even simulate the feel of different types of lies, such as fairway, rough, and sand. This adds another layer of realism to the experience and challenges you to adapt your swing accordingly. But the technology doesn't just enhance the gaming experience; it also provides valuable feedback that can help you improve your game. The simulators can analyze your swing and identify areas where you can make adjustments. They can also provide data on your clubhead speed, ball speed, and launch angle, which can help you optimize your swing for distance and accuracy. Some simulators even offer video analysis, allowing you to compare your swing to that of a professional golfer like Tiger Woods. This can be a great way to identify flaws in your technique and make corrections. In addition to the hardware and software, many Tiger Woods golf simulator bars also offer professional instruction. You can work with a certified golf instructor who can use the simulator to analyze your swing and provide personalized feedback. This can be a great way to take your game to the next level. Why Choose a Golf Simulator Bar Over a Traditional Golf Course?

So, why choose a golf simulator bar over a traditional golf course? There are a bunch of reasons, actually. First off, convenience is a huge factor. You don't have to worry about booking tee times, driving to the course, or dealing with unpredictable weather. You can just walk into the simulator bar, grab a drink, and start playing. Plus, you can play any course in the world, no matter where you are located. Want to tee off at Augusta National or St. Andrews? No problem! The simulator can transport you there instantly. Another advantage is the ability to play year-round, regardless of the weather. Rain, snow, or extreme heat won't stop you from enjoying a round of golf in the comfort of the simulator bar. This is especially appealing for golfers who live in areas with harsh climates. Additionally, golf simulator bars offer a more social and relaxed atmosphere than traditional golf courses. You can play with friends, enjoy drinks and snacks, and chat without worrying about disturbing other golfers. It's a great way to combine your love for golf with your desire for a fun and engaging social experience. Furthermore, simulators provide instant feedback on your swing, allowing you to identify areas for improvement. You can track your clubhead speed, ball speed, launch angle, and spin rate, and use this data to fine-tune your technique. Some simulators even offer video analysis, allowing you to compare your swing to that of a professional golfer. This level of feedback is simply not available on a traditional golf course. Moreover, golf simulator bars can be more affordable than traditional golf courses, especially if you factor in the cost of green fees, cart rentals, and equipment. You can often play a round of golf on a simulator for a fraction of the cost of playing on a real course. Finally, golf simulator bars are a great option for beginners who are new to the game. The simulators provide a low-pressure environment where you can learn the basics of golf without feeling intimidated. You can practice your swing, experiment with different clubs, and get comfortable with the game before venturing out onto a real course.
